SKY TV extends Joseph Parker’s reach by 18,000km in debut campaign via Hello, Auckland
SKY TV is rallying the country ahead of the heavyweight title unification between our home town hero Joseph Parker and Anthony Joshua. The WBO, WBA, IBF and IBO titles are on the line as the pair square off this weekend in-front of 80,000 screaming boxing fans in Cardiff.
The emotionally charged 60-second film, created by Hello, Auckland, features Parker’s mother, Sala, who recounts memories of her son’s journey to the top, his proudest moments, personal memorabilia and, at the end of the film, invites the country to rally behind her boy by sending personal messages of support to www.ShoutOutForJoe.co.nz. The messages are sent to the other side of the world to appear on a large digital billboard in the heart of Cardiff, for Joseph and the world to see.
“This is his biggest fight and we want to show Joe we’re all behind him, all of Sky TV, all of New Zealand. We’re rallying the country to show their patriotic support for him on a world stage. He’s about to walk into an arena of 80,000 screaming British boxing fans and we want to let him know he’s not alone. It’s heartfelt messages from his Kiwi fans, his Samoan fans, right in the heart of Cardiff” says Kristy Simpson, Head of Digital, Sky TV.
Mike Watson, Director of Marketing, Sky TV, echo’s the sentiment: “It’s a great way for the country to get behind Joseph Parker, on the world stage. We’re so far away, but through this campaign Kiwis can get closer to the build-up of the historic fight. A great idea and clever mix of digital media has delivered a brilliant outcome by the team and agencies involved.”
The campaign has launched on television, digital and social media. The film was produced by Curious.
